The Role

An exciting opportunity has become available for a Registered Veterinary Nurse to join Plymouth Veterinary Group! The day-to-day duties can include nurse consultations, monitoring of anaesthetics, recovering surgical patients, medicating patients, assisting consulting Vets and providing exceptional client care.

You will be working various shifts as directed by the Nurse rota including 8 hourly shifts such as 7:00am – 4:00pm, 9:00am – 6:00pm, 2:00pm – 11:00pm and 3:00pm - midnight. Weekend work is also required for which lieu days are given if working full time. 

The Salary offered for a 40-hour week is up to £26,000 per annum depending on experience with additional enhancements for certificate holders.

About Us

Plymouth Veterinary Group is a companion animal multi-site practice with a flagship Hospital and 4 branch surgeries serving all areas of Plymouth. The Hospital is 24/7 365 days per year providing an out-of-hours service for other feeder practices within the area.

The Practice is well equipped with digital Xray, Ultrasound, Endoscopy, Laparoscopy, and other diagnostic equipment enabling most first opinion cases to be treated in-house as well as accepting referrals for exotics.

The team is made up of 15 Veterinary Surgeons and 28 Registered Veterinary Nurses covering 5 sites 24/7 many of which are certificate holders alongside a large support team of Receptionists, Administrators, and Veterinary Care Assistants.

The Practice prides itself on being a training practice for both Student Nurses and New Graduate Vets and fosters a learning culture to support further development for all staff.
